TCCNHS Roommate FAQs

What are some qualities to look for in a roommate at The Christ College of Nursing and Health Sciences? It's important to find someone who values academic success and understands the demands of the nursing program. A responsible roommate who is tidy, respectful, and communicates effectively can help create a conducive living environment for learning and studying. How can I find a roommate at The Christ College of Nursing and Health Sciences who shares my interests and values? Consider attending social events and activities organized by the college to meet other nursing students and establish connections with those who share similar interests and goals. You can also use social media platforms and roommate-finding websites to connect with potential roommates who are attending the same college. What should I do if I have problems with my roommate at The Christ College of Nursing and Health Sciences? If you encounter issues with your roommate, it's important to address them in a respectful and timely manner. The college offers support services and resources such as counseling, mediation, and housing staff who can provide advice, guidance, and assistance to help resolve any conflicts that may arise. Additionally, make sure to familiarize yourself with the college's housing policies and guidelines to ensure you and your roommate are following the rules and regulations.
